About Adi Rahayu 401 Dive

ADI RAHAYU is the sister company of ADIASSRI and Mr. Komang Sumantri is the Owner from all sources of business under PT. ADI SUMANTRI.His Success in carved the curve lagoon shore the fisher village of Pemuteran become a beauty area worth for the tourism and local peoples and their activity become an attraction on behalf of Resort program. Those collaboration idea had effected them on how the Local people on fishers village would take for a granted to keep it nature as a safe place for the resort’s guest at the area. The other benefit have been owning monthly by the community was the amount share provided by the Hotel directly to the community.Dive site MENJANGAN ISLAND is one of a few world best dive area as the main target of divers came and stay at Pemuteran. Since there are an extra charge for the entrance fee was rising up included the grown handling, it cause Dive Site of Menjangan become a quiet expensive program effect those basic cost itself not include the 15 minutes Car transportation to the harbor plus the cost for adventure across by traditional wooden boat.We will mostly introduce divers a huge alternative dive spot as the second option or target in package holidays to have more possibility to explores the Northern Bali dive sites from various Local reefs along Pemuteran bay, experience the coral garden karang lestari ( bio rock ) it just a spectacular shore dive.

Africa - Kenya

Scuba diving in Kenya offers an unforgettable underwater experience, showcasing spectacular coral reefs, abundant marine wildlife, and clear, warm waters. From the renowned dive sites around Watamu Marine Park to the thriving ecosystems of Kisite-Mpunguti Marine Reserve, divers of all levels will find vibrant coral gardens, colorful tropical fish, dolphins, whale sharks, and even manta rays. Kenya's idyllic coastal towns like Diani and Malindi provide perfect bases for exploring underwater treasures, making it an ideal destination for adventure-seekers and nature enthusiasts alike.

Honduras is an exceptional destination for scuba diving, renowned for its crystal-clear Caribbean waters, abundant coral reefs, and incredible marine biodiversity. The Bay Islands—Roatán, Utila, and Guanaja—feature vibrant coral gardens, dramatic underwater walls, and thriving marine ecosystems ideal for divers of every level. Roatán's famed dive sites like Mary's Place and West Bay offer spectacular coral formations and encounters with eagle rays, turtles, and colorful tropical fish, while Utila is celebrated globally for its frequent whale shark sightings. With excellent visibility and dive-friendly conditions year-round, Honduras promises unforgettable underwater experiences for adventure-seekers and nature lovers alike.

Scuba diving in Japan presents a captivating blend of tropical reefs, dramatic underwater topography, and abundant marine biodiversity. From Okinawa’s turquoise waters, home to vibrant coral gardens, sea turtles, and manta rays, to the unique volcanic landscapes and temperate marine life of the Izu Peninsula near Tokyo, divers of all skill levels can experience unforgettable underwater adventures. Seasonal highlights include hammerhead shark encounters, schooling fish, and exceptional visibility. Japan's diverse dive sites offer unique experiences year-round, making it an extraordinary destination for divers eager to explore the Pacific’s hidden treasures.
